微波电子自旋共振实验波形分析

摘    要:详细分析了微波段用可调反射式谐振腔做电子自旋共振实验中共振信号的形成原理,分析指出下凹和上凸波形都为共振吸收信号,当波形的上下两部分等大时,为色散信号,波形的上下两部分不等大时,为色散信号和共振吸收信号的合成。从理论上解释了共振信号的变化所反映的物理过程。

Analysis of Waveforms in Electron Spin Resonance Experiment

Abstract:The waveforms in electron spin resonance experiment using adjustable reflective resonant cavity were analyzed,The analysis indicates the convex and the concave waveforms are absorb signals,if the top part and the bottom part of the signal are equal,the signal is dispersed signal,the others are combined by absorb signals and dispersed signal.The change process of resonance singal is explained.
